Distillerie Meyer - Gin
Origin and background
The Meyer Distillery, renowned for its craft brandies and whiskies, has developed a gin that respects tradition while making the most of local resources. Produced in a traditional still, this Alsatian gin is based on a refined neutral grain base, infused with juniper berries and a bouquet of herbs and spices, with a rigorous selection of citrus fruits and local plants for a profile that is both classic and regional.
Tasting
Nose: Clean and expressive. Predominantly juniper, accompanied by fresh citrus notes, aromatic herbs and delicate spices.
Palate: Lively and well-balanced. Straightforward juniper attack, evolving towards lemony, slightly peppery flavours. Silky texture, lovely aromatic intensity with a long, dry finish, marked by the freshness of the herbs and the purity of the spices.
Suggested pairings
Perfect on its own or on the rocks to appreciate the finesse of the botanicals. Ideal as a gin and tonic with a neutral or lightly lemony tonic, garnished with lemon zest or a sprig of fresh rosemary. It also lends itself to more elaborate cocktails such as Negroni, Martini Dry or French 75. It goes well with oysters, salmon gravlax or fresh, creamy cheeses such as chèvre or Saint-Moret.
